Frame Damage

uPVC is a great building material, allowing homeowners to have extremely secure, energy efficient windows for a low cost. Even the most well-constructed uPVC window can deteriorate or get damaged over time. Fortunately, the majority of this damage can be easily fixed by a seasoned window specialist.

One of the most common problems that can be encountered with uPVC is scratch marks or dents on the frames and cills. This can be due to many reasons, including general wear and tear, or accidents such as dropping a heavy object on the window frame. In most cases, the marks can be cleaned up with a simple cleaning solution. However, more serious damage can require a professional repair service.

A broken or loose handle hinge or latch is a common issue. This can be a real inconvenience, as it could stop you from opening or closing your window. The window can be repaired with new parts from a window repair upvc windows specialist, restoring the functionality of your window.

In some instances, the uPVC window frame itself can begin to deteriorate and cause issues such as water infiltration or loss of insulation. A window repair expert can fix this problem by replacing any seals or other parts that are damaged.

Keep your uPVC window frames clean to avoid costly repairs. Clean your uPVC windows at least once a year to remove dust and dust from the frame and glass. Regularly lubricating all moving parts on the outside such as handles and hinges, with WD-40 will make them last longer and work more effectively. This will also help to keep from rusting on the metal parts, which can lead to the need for more costly repairs. It is advisable to contact a specialist in window repair when you notice signs of rust on handles or hinges. They can address the problem quickly before it gets worse.

Glass Damage

UPVC is a durable material that can withstand a significant amount of wear and tear. UPVC is susceptible to damage, however, by fluctuating temperatures and weather conditions. Luckily, there are some actions you can take to avoid or repair damage to your double-glazed windows and doors without contacting an expert.

It is crucial to clean your uPVC windows on a regular basis. You should wipe it down using a soft white cloth that has been immersed in soapy water and liquid. Focus on the corners where dirt is likely to build up. You should do this at least four times a year. Avoid cleaning your uPVC window in direct sunlight since this can cause streaks.

If your uPVC windows have become discolored and stained, you can clean the grime with a special solvent cleaner that is made to be used on plastic. You can find this product at any home improvement or hardware retailer. It is recommended that you read the label before using any product. Be careful not to get the cleaner on flooring or furniture as it may damage them.

One of the main advantages of uPVC windows is that they don't require to be painted. Wood windows are more prone to decay and require regular painting. Additionally, they should be sanded down and treated to protect them from weather changes. This makes UPVC the superior option for your double-glazed windows.

Epoxy can be used to repair cracks in uPVC windows. This is a more complex process, but it will ensure that the crack won't persist and will affect the appearance of your windows. First, you must clean the crack using a soft cotton rag. Then, you must apply the epoxy according to the manufacturer's instructions.

Avoid slamming uPVC windows. A repeated blow to the window could cause a broken seal and also condensation between glass panes. This could cause drafts and more energy bills.

Seals

uPVC windows offer a beautiful and energy-efficient choice for your home. They provide many advantages, such as insulation, durability and security. These windows are prone to damage. It's better to repair your uPVC windows than replace them if they're damaged. Repairing your uPVC window will maintain its appearance and function, while saving you money in the end.

If you have multi-pane windows The most frequent issue is that they could get fogged or misty. This is caused by the condensation that occurs between the panes of windows and can be a difficult problem to solve. While defogging solutions are readily available, many do not work and can worsen the issue. You should hire a window specialist instead to reseal your IGU (insulating glazing unit).

Gaskets are the most efficient method of repairing uPVC windows. You can do this by cleaning the surface of the glass and frame to get rid of any dust or debris. Then, you can employ a caulking gun or manual applicator to apply the new sealant in an even line. Once the sealant has been applied then, you can use a putty tool or any other tool designed to smooth the sealant. This will ensure that it is covered the entire gap.

It is also important to ensure that you regularly clean your uPVC window frames and glass. Using a damp cloth to wipe the surface will help remove any dirt or dust. This is especially helpful if you reside in an area where there is a lot wind, since it helps prevent debris from building up on your windows. Also, you should make sure to keep the hinges of your uPVC windows well-lubricated so that they can open and close quickly. Spray cans of WD-40 work as an efficient lubricant.
